"God is always going to change your heart before He changes your shirt." - Mark Hall, Casting Crowns
Understand that God wants to bless you financially. But He wants your heart to be connected to Him. He wants your heart to be transformed and your will subjected to the influence of the Holy Spirit.
Thus, He will train you to develop spiritual virtues like faithfulness, integrity, patience, and yielding to the Holy Ghost.
This is so that...
First, you can appreciate financial stewardship; such that you appreciate the truth that 100% of the money that comes to you is from and for God. And that you're just a steward of the money.
Secondly, He can be sure that He is putting his finances in the hand of a faithful servant. And that with His guidance and instructions, you as a faithful servant will manage [Invest, save, use, donate, etc] His money.
If you receive proper light on financial stewardship, you'll begin to experience true financial prosperity. Shalom!

To walk in financial freedom, you first need to understand that it is God's will for you to prosper financially. He wants you to prosper more than you can ever imagine for your self.
God didn't create you to be poor and needy all the time. As a believer, you are destined to be a blessing to the people around you [Gen 12:2]. Having financial prosperity surely plays a role in you being a blessing to others.
Also, God wants you to prosper and get wealthy, so you can fulfill his purpose and plans for your life. The scripture says,
"But thou shalt remember the LORD thy God: for [it is] he that giveth thee power to get wealth, that he may establish his covenant.."[Deut 8:18].
God gives you the power and the ability to get wealth so you can pursue his vision for your life. This is vital, for you to fully acknowledge that it is God's desire to make you wealthy.
Refuse to believe any thoughts and ideas that force you to accept poverty and lack. Nobody has received an award for being poor yet. Embrace God's will for you today; He wants you to prosper. You believe that?

“God Puts Sickness on You to Teach You Something”
by Gloria Copeland
Today, I’m continuing the series, Lies Christians Believe about Healing. This is close to my heart because I have witnessed thousands of people healed in my Healing School meetings. These healings weren’t dependent on me. No, these healings were dependent on what Jesus did 2,000 years ago. All I do—glory to God, what I have the privilege to do—is help open peoples’ eyes to what the Word of God says. That’s what I want to do today. So let’s look at the second religious tradition—or lie—Christians believe about healing. Let’s identify it and get it out of our lives so we can get on with what God has called us to do.
Lie #2: God puts sickness on you to teach you something.
I imagine the whole throne room of God shudders over this religious tradition. It’s totally contrary to the Scriptures. Nowhere in the Bible does God say that we learn truth and grow up in Him by suffering sickness, disease and turmoil. Not once in the New Testament does it say that sickness is the teacher of the Church.
On the contrary, the Bible says, “All scripture is given by inspiration of God, and is profitable for doctrine, for reproof, for correction, for instruction in righteousness: that the man of God may be perfect, thoroughly furnished unto all good works” (2 Timothy 3:16-17).
Look at those verses again. What do they say corrects us?
God’s Word!
What do they say instructs us, furnishes us and makes us perfect (or mature)?
God’s Word!
In addition to His Word, God has also given us the Holy Spirit to be our teacher. That’s why it’s important for us not only to be born again but filled with the Spirit. Jesus said the Holy Spirit is the One who will “teach you all things” (John 14:26). He is the One who will “guide you into all truth” (John 16:13).
If we want God to teach us something, we don’t have to go out and catch the flu. All we have to do is take time to open our Bibles. We can just read the Word, believe what it says, and let the Holy Spirit show us how to apply it to our lives.
It’s a simple process. Anyone can do it, and I can tell you from years of experience, it’s a lot of fun. I love getting up in the morning and heading for my prayer-and-Bible-reading place first thing. I always get happy looking in the Word and seeing what belongs to me as a believer. It’s a great way to start the day.
If you haven’t already made it a habit to spend daily time in the Word, do it now. It will change your life. You can’t read the Word, believe it and fellowship with the Holy Spirit, and stay sick and defeated. God’s Words “are life to those who find them, healing and health to all their flesh” (Proverbs 4:22).
What you learn from the Word will bring victory in every area of life!

Entertain Angels - 1
Manoah did not realize that it was the angel of the Lord [Judges 13:16, NIV]
Manoah’s wife was barren for years. In the absence of Manoah, a Man of God appears to her and prophesies that she will conceive and bear a child. She brings the good news to her husband, Manoah. He prays to have an encounter with this man of God. God hears his prayers and the man of God comes back to meet him.
This man of God, possibly dressed and appeared as any ordinary man, had nothing significant about him. Nothing too special about him, nothing Angelic about him. And yet, he was the Angel of the Lord. He was an Angel hiding in the bones of human. God had sent him to change the course of the Manoah’s life and the destiny of an entire nation.
Manoah didn’t realize he was an angel initially. But thankfully, he was willing to honor and consciously entertain him. And he was rewarded tremendously for it. He was exposed to purpose, and he eventually fulfilled his destiny.
How many times have we missed the Angels that God has sent our way?
Friends, there are angels hiding in the bones of humans that God brings our way all the time; angels that carry the keys to our destiny. They carry the blessings that we need to become everything God has created us to be.
They might not carry wings on their back. They might not have anything too special about them. They could be ordinary human beings. And yet they show up at the right time, and release the blessed word of the Lord on our lives.
In this new decade, look out for angels like that.
Look out for people who express faith in you, whose prophetic words are seasoned with grace. Consciously entertain them! Connect with them! They are angels. They are destiny helpers!
“Don't forget to be kind to strangers, for some who have done this have entertained angels without realizing it!” [Heb 13:2, TLB]
